Zgwatinib (SOMG-833) is a potent, selective, and ATP-competitive c-MET inhibitor, with an IC50 of 0.93 nM against c-MET, over 10,000-fold more potent compared with 19 tyrosine kinases (including c-MET family members and highly homologous kinases). Zgwatinib potently inhibits c-MET-driven cell proliferation. Zgwatinib as a potential candidate agent for c-MET-driven human cancers research[1].
